1935 Green Bay Packers season

The 1935 Green Bay Packers season was their 17th season overall and their 15th season in the National Football League. The club posted an 8–4 record under coach Curly Lambeau, earning them a second-place finish in the Western Conference. They failed to qualify for the playoffs for the fourth consecutive season.
